Solution

Here's is the difference - See below images

simple_spinner_item

If you're using your spinner with `spinner.setAdapter(adapter);` directly in your code, your spinner will looks like above image.

But, if you're using `adapter.setDropDownViewResource(android.R.layout.simple_spinner_dropdown_item);` in your code, it'll show your spinner like below image where the spinner items will shown with radio buttons.

simple_spinner_dropdown_item

Problem

Here's a sample code of using spinner in android : ``` Spinner spinner = (Spinner) findViewById(R.id.spinner); ArrayAdapter<CharSequence> adapter = ArrayAdapter.createFromResource(this, R.array.gender_array, android.R.layout.simple_spinner_item); adapter.setDropDownViewResource(android.R.layout.simple_spinner_dropdown_item); spinner.setAdapter(adapter); ``` I have understood that we need to specify a layout for the datarows in the adapter But why again using `setDropDownViewResource()` method. I mean what does this function do and also tell me how it is different from the constructor of the `ArrayAdapter`. I have gone through the documentation, but didn't understand completely.
